Saint-Léger-Magnazeix, a region located in the Haute-Vienne department of the Nouvelle-Aquitaine region in west-central France, offers a tranquil and unspoiled natural environment for outdoor pursuits. The area is characterized by rolling hills, dense woodlands, and serene waterways, typical of the Limousin countryside. This landscape, often referred to as the Limousin Bocage, features meadows, pastures, and chestnut thickets, providing varied terrain suitable for several sports like touring cycling, hiking, road cycling, jogging, and more.

The region features several points of interest, including the 12th-century Prieuré des Bronzeaux, a Grandmontain monastery. The Etang de Murat is a Natura 2000 zone with an ornithological observatory, and an ancient Roman bridge at Puy Saint Jean adds historical charm. These sites can be incorporated into outdoor excursions.
